From b3a9a0c36e1f7b9e2e6cf965c2bb973624f2b3b9 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Dan Williams Date: Wed, 2 May 2018 06:46:33 -0700 Subject: dax: Introduce a ->copy_to_iter dax operation Similar to the ->copy_from_iter() operation, a platform may want to deploy an architecture or device specific routine for handling reads from a dax_device like /dev/pmemX. On x86 this routine will point to a machine check safe version of copy_to_iter(). For now, add the plumbing to device-mapper and the dax core.
